Output 8367be79be982618c6831c43a77a6cc7a3b95c44fff44aa685d708f5fba1b2c4:76

value
671273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87149e76a1267a6c20f31971992e6b1f33ac626 OP_EQUAL
address
3MRTbR2i1rb3Zzr8vjuTP4N1itqGtXwkik
transaction
8367be79be982618c6831c43a77a6cc7a3b95c44fff44aa685d708f5fba1b2c4
confirmations
16624
spent
true